The Importance of Women-Only Detox Centers

Women-only detox centers play a crucial role in the field of addiction recovery by offering specialized and gender-responsive care. These centers provide an environment that caters specifically to the unique needs of women, acknowledging the social, psychological, and physical challenges they face. Many women in addiction recovery confront distinct issues such as co-occurring mental health disorders and societal pressures, which are different from the experiences of men as indicated by American Addiction Centers. By creating a space free from gender dynamics, women-only rehabs help reduce stigma, allowing for more effective healing and recovery outcomes.

Specialized Care in Women-Only Detox Centers

One of the primary advantages of women-only detox centers is their ability to provide specialized care tailored to women’s unique challenges. Centers like New Directions for Women offer comprehensive programs that address substance use disorders alongside co-occurring mental health conditions such as anxiety, depression, and PTSD. This integrated approach ensures that women receive holistic treatment targeted at both their physical and emotional well-being. Additionally, women-only centers often provide trauma-informed care and support for survivors of domestic violence, understanding the intertwined nature of trauma and substance use as highlighted by Addiction Center.

Range of Treatment Options

Women-only rehab programs offer various levels of care, allowing customization to fit individual needs. These programs include inpatient, outpatient, detoxification services, and sober living facilities. Initial assessments help determine the most appropriate level of care, ensuring that each woman receives a personalized treatment plan. Facilities like the Georgia Strait Women’s Clinic exemplify a model of trauma-focused care, integrating therapeutic activities that promote community and healing as noted by Recovery.com. This flexibility is vital for women juggling responsibilities such as motherhood, legal issues, or housing stability.

Creating a Supportive Environment

Women-only rehab centers focus on fostering a supportive community where participants can share experiences with peers facing similar issues. This sense of community is vital for building trust and ensuring engagement in treatment. The supportive environment minimizes external distractions, allowing women to focus entirely on recovery efforts. By prioritizing safety and comprehensive treatment planning, these centers can effectively address challenges such as identity issues, behavioral therapy, and specific substance use disorders tied to women’s experiences as discussed by Rehabs.com.

Affordability and Accessibility

Financial considerations are an essential aspect of entering treatment. Women-only detox centers often offer various options to make their services more accessible. Health insurance coverage, government funding, or sliding scale payment methods help alleviate the economic burden associated with rehab, making treatment feasible for a broader demographic. Centers like New Directions for Women frequently have programs in place to ensure financial accessibility, though it is recommended that people verify specifics directly with the facility and their own insurance providers.
